Hello everyone,

Two weeks ago my account got restricted after I changed my name because I obtained another citizenship and my legal name changed. I have sent dozens of emails to LinkedIn customer support, but they keep sending generic responses without providing any kind of solution.

So what are my options here? I thought about creating a new account, but I’m afraid that it will get restricted as well. Also, I have no clue how I can restore my account data because they ask for identity verification in order to give me the data, but at the same time they don’t accept my identity verification, which is what led to the account restriction in the first place.

Note: My account is temporarily restricted, not permanently.
